Lego lapdancers cause controversy

Parents will probably want to keep their kids away from the latest Lego creation - it's an adult strip club.

The set, produced by Citizen Brick, includes four minifigures and a club with zebra-print couches and a pole.

And just like a real night out at an exotic dance joint, the entertainment doesn't come cheap: The whole Lego set costs $275.

Citizen Brick owner Joe Trupia boasts he's sold a few hundred so far. The company has been customising Legos since 2010. It produced a popular "Breaking Bad"-like set last year.

"We're fanatically doing things that Lego wouldn't do," explains Trupia.
